Wood Pulp Futures and Options Launch
Effective
Sunday, September 9, 2007 (for trade date Monday, September 10), Northern Bleach
Softwood Kraft Pulp Europe (Softwood Pulp) futures and options will launch on the CME Globex
platform. Softwood Pulp options will be eligible for User-Defined Spreads (UDS) Combos and Covereds
at launch.

Intercommodity Spread for Equity Futures
Effective
Sunday, September 9, 2007 (for trade date Monday, September 10), a new
intercommodity spread between the new E-mini S&P SmallCap 600 and the E-mini Russell 2000®
futures will be available for trading on the CME Globex platform.
The new spread, Strategy Type Code
IR, is a 2:1 ratio spread and will not support implied functionality.
The IR intercommodity spread is currently available in New Release for customer testing.

E-mini S&P SmallCap 600 Group Code
Change
Effective
this Sunday, August 26 (for trade date Monday, August 27), the Instrument Group
Code for the E-mini S&P SmallCap 600 futures will change to
ER. Currently the Instrument Group Code for the E-mini S&P SmallCap 600
futures is EP. This change will be effective in all customer environments - Production,
Certification and New Release.
The Instrument Group Code can be found in the Instrument Creation (MO) RLC market data message
at position 70-71. New Instrument Group Codes may require front-end system or trading application
changes. Please contact your system provider for more information.

Updated ATS Policy and FAQ
The CME Group policy for Automated Trading Systems (ATS) identification and registration has
been amended to set the procedures and policies for registering ATS operators when a team of people
work together simultaneously to operate the ATS.
All clearing firms must ensure that ATS workstation operator identifier (SenderSubID, FIX tag
50) values are properly and accurately registered when so required as set forth in the Advisory.
Some ATS are now being managed by groups of individuals that simultaneously share operating and
monitoring duties. Effective August 27, 2007, the Exchange Fee System ("EFS") will support the
registration of these teams. While at this time the policy only applies to CME products, it is
anticipated that the policy will be applied to CBOT products when those products migrate to the CME
Globex platform.
This advisory will discuss the circumstances under which Team ATS may be registered, and the
procedures for doing so.
